Output cef7b045b68fbfa2f30140609929c25d945cd9d8fab897be4e7d66247a8c40ea:3

value
10758600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e5d6d9522312bb87ae947beda3bfaa12371ed9 OP_EQUAL
address
3DzHom41QY4vuZU3XMW4QPiXdBRgZLBCfC
transaction
cef7b045b68fbfa2f30140609929c25d945cd9d8fab897be4e7d66247a8c40ea
spent
true